The drive from Jacksonwald, PA to Croydon, PA covers 75.5 miles and takes about 1h 29m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.
The route leans on Pennsylvania Turnpike, Morgantown Expressway, Street Road for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is highway-focused dr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 53.1 miles on Pennsylvania Turnpike. At current regular gas prices, budget about $12.52 one way before food or hotel costs.

This is a 1h 29m highway drive covering 75.5 miles, with most of the trip on Pennsylvania Turnpike and Morgantown Expressway. The longest continuous stretch is about 53.1 miles on Pennsylvania Turnpike.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on Pennsylvania Turnpike and Morgantown Expressway. This route has several spots where lane changes, forks, or exits need your full attention. The trickiest moment comes around 2 miles in near US 422 / West Shore Bypass.
